Output d669dd76401de8fa780fa6c2f4e74eb1afd3282f7d9f41ca73858541d015667e:0

value
10682385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23e04bb2aaf1e248f8ea39d03cdf38ba8d1b5ced OP_EQUAL
address
34xiGbWvdhW4WWMzxFW2voTtF2ttWDPnoX
transaction
d669dd76401de8fa780fa6c2f4e74eb1afd3282f7d9f41ca73858541d015667e
spent
true